摘 要:用4℃低温处理玉米白交系幼苗二天发现细胞保护酶活性和胞质质量发生有规律的变化:抗冷力弱的自交系过氧化氢酶、过氧化物酶、超氧物歧化酶活性降低,原生质层透性亦降低,但膜脂过氧化水平显著增高;抗冷力强的自交系细胞保护酶活性增高,膜脂过氧化水平未发生明显变化,但原生质层透性和和滞度显著增加.这一结果表明保护酶活性和胞质质量与玉米抗冷性密切相关.After two days of 4℃ treatment at three-leaf stage, the activities of eatalasc, pcroxidase and supcroxidc dismutasc, and permeability of protoplast layer to nonclcctrotes declined, but level of membrane lipid pcroxidation increased in the leaves of cold sensitive inbred line of maize. In the cold resistant line, by contrast, the activities of the three protective enzymes, and permeability and viscosity of protoplast increased, and correspondingly, membrane lipid pcroxidation had no significant change. The results suggested that there ight be a close relationship between the activities of enzymes investigated or protoplasmic parameters and cold resistance of maize.
